Job DescriptionPosition Overview: The Care Coordinator will operate as a member of the multidisciplinary treatment team by working closely with clinical, business development, admissions, and nursing staff. The Care Coordinator will maintain collaboration and coordination between internal treatment team and external constituents, providing a high level of customer service and satisfaction amongst everyone with whom they interact. A main goal of this role is to foster positive relationships between the sites and all external stakeholders. Further, they will coordinate continued care following inpatient treatment to include scheduling all appointments and communicate with all collateral supports (referral sources, family, etc) regarding appointments. The Care Coordinator is responsible to ensure the patients feel ready and understand fully their plans following inpatient treatment. This includes making a connection between the patient and next level providers prior to discharge. The Care Coordinator will also assist patients with any outside issues or external stressors that need to be resolved, enabling patient to focus on treatment (ex, coordinate with family for childcare, call work, pay bills, etc). In summary, the main goal of this position is to improve communication with everyone inside of our patient's ecosystem for the purposes of improved patient care and increasing awareness of the superior care delivered by RCA within the greater community. Through this process, RCA will see increased organic referrals and be the provider of choice within our local communities. Specific Responsibilities: * Complete Releases of Information for all stakeholders in patient's ecosystem (patient support system, referents, existing treating providers, PCP). * Gather patient history, needs, and special requests to inform treatment plan from all stakeholders * Communicates to clinical team information from all outside constituents to inform treatment planning * Follow all referent protocols * Assesses the need for FMLA and Short-term Disability for referral to Financial Counselors * Complete all ongoing communication with referents throughout treatment and upon discharge * Review Biopsychosocial assessment, identify all life domain needs, incorporate these identified needs into the Continued Care Plan to ensure patient has follow up for each identified need. * Confirm all appointments on continued care plan address all of the following: substance use, mental health, MAT, and all other identified life domains * Keep family and all external constituents informed of transition planning as it evolves throughout treatment * Ensures all continued care plans are solidified 1 week prior to discharge * All efforts must be made to schedule appointments with in network providers * Facilitate Transition of Care meetings prior to discharge date to review and confirm next step plans with all key stakeholders * Send all Continued Care Plan documentation to receiving treatment providers * Document regularly in the medical record ongoing progress towards care coordination treatment goals. * Act as an advocate for all patients when working with external providers and speaking on their behalf * Work collectively with the clinical team to engage, educate, and coordinate patient care with the patient, their identified supports, and community providers to ensure all services prescribed are implemented prior to treatment completion. * This job description is not designed to cover or contain a comprehensive listing of activities, duties or responsibilities that are required of the employee for this job. How much does a Counselor earn in Ross, PA?
The average counselor in Ross, PA earns between $18,000 and $63,000 annually. This compares to the national average counselor range of $19,000 to $67,000.
What is the job market like for counselors in Ross, PA?
The job market is good for counselors in Ross, PA. The number of counselor jobs have grown by 726% in the last year. Right now there are currently 355 counselor jobs available in Ross, PA.
